Importance of Smart Business Travel Management

Efficient travel management is crucial for professionals as it can significantly impact productivity, cost savings, and overall success in business endeavors. By implementing smart business travel practices, professionals can streamline their travel arrangements, optimize their schedules, and enhance their overall travel experience.

Benefits of Smart Business Travel Practices

  • Cost Savings: Effective travel management can help professionals save money by booking flights and accommodations in advance, taking advantage of discounts, and avoiding unnecessary expenses.
  • Time Efficiency: By planning and organizing travel itineraries efficiently, professionals can minimize travel time, reduce delays, and maximize productivity during trips.
  • Productivity Boost: Smart travel management allows professionals to stay organized, focus on work tasks while traveling, and maintain a work-life balance, leading to increased productivity.
  • Enhanced Safety and Security: Proper travel management includes risk assessment, emergency planning, and access to support services, ensuring the safety and security of professionals on their business trips.

Examples of Effective Travel Management

  • Utilizing Travel Management Tools: Professionals can leverage online booking platforms, travel apps, and expense management systems to simplify travel arrangements and track expenses effectively.
  • Strategic Planning: By creating detailed itineraries, setting priorities, and anticipating potential challenges, professionals can navigate their business trips smoothly and achieve their objectives efficiently.
  • Preferred Vendor Relationships: Establishing partnerships with preferred airlines, hotels, and car rental companies can lead to exclusive deals, loyalty rewards, and personalized services, enhancing the overall travel experience.

Tools and Technologies for Business Travel

Managing business trips effectively requires the use of various tools and technologies to streamline the process and ensure a smooth travel experience.

Essential Tools for Business Travel Management

  • Online Booking Platforms: Platforms like Expedia, Booking.com, and Kayak allow professionals to easily book flights, accommodation, and transportation for their business trips.
  • Expense Tracking Software: Tools like Expensify or Concur help travelers keep track of their expenses and streamline the reimbursement process.
  • Itinerary Management Tools: Apps like TripIt or Google Trips organize travel plans, including flight details, hotel reservations, and meeting schedules, in one place for easy access.
  • Travel Risk Management Software: Programs like International SOS or WorldAware provide real-time alerts and assistance in case of emergencies during travel.

Comparison of Travel Management Platforms

  • Concur: Offers end-to-end travel management solutions, including booking, expense reporting, and compliance tracking.
  • SAP Concur: Integrates with other business systems for seamless data flow and provides detailed analytics for cost optimization.
  • TravelPerk: Focuses on user-friendly interface and customer service, with features like automated expense reporting and travel policy compliance.

Mobile Apps for Simplifying Business Travel

  • Booking Apps: Platforms like Skyscanner and Airbnb allow travelers to book flights and accommodations on the go, with real-time updates and notifications.
  • Expense Tracking Apps: Apps like Expensify and Zoho Expense automate expense reporting, capturing receipts, and categorizing expenses for easy reimbursement.
  • Itinerary Apps: Tools like TripIt and Kayak consolidate travel plans, itineraries, and trip details in one place, accessible offline for convenience.

Cost-saving Strategies for Business Travel

When it comes to business travel, managing costs effectively is crucial for optimizing your company’s budget. By implementing smart cost-saving strategies, you can ensure that your business trips are both efficient and economical.

Tips for Booking Cost-effective Flights, Accommodations, and Transportation

One of the key ways to save on business travel expenses is by carefully planning and booking cost-effective flights, accommodations, and transportation options. Here are some tips to help you achieve this:

  • Book flights in advance to take advantage of early bird discounts and lower prices.
  • Consider alternative airports or travel dates to find cheaper flight options.
  • Use hotel booking platforms or corporate discounts to secure affordable accommodations.
  • Opt for public transportation or ride-sharing services instead of expensive taxis or rental cars.

The Importance of Setting and Adhering to a Travel Budget

Setting a clear travel budget is essential for keeping costs in check and ensuring that your business trips remain within financial limits. Here are some reasons why setting and adhering to a travel budget is important:

  • Helps track expenses and avoid overspending during business trips.
  • Allows for better planning and allocation of resources for each trip.
  • Enables you to make informed decisions based on budget constraints and priorities.
  • Ensures accountability and transparency in managing travel expenses within the organization.

Ways to Minimize Expenses During Business Trips

While cutting costs is important, it’s equally essential to ensure that your business trips are comfortable and productive. Here are some ways to minimize expenses without compromising on quality:

  • Opt for budget-friendly accommodation options that still offer comfort and amenities.
  • Look for dining deals or meal vouchers to save on food expenses during your trip.
  • Utilize technology tools for expense tracking and reimbursement to streamline the process.
  • Consider bundling travel expenses like flights and accommodations for potential discounts.

Safety and Security Measures for Business Travel

When it comes to business travel, ensuring safety and security is paramount for professionals on the go. From travel insurance to emergency preparedness, taking necessary precautions can make a significant difference in maintaining a secure environment while traveling for work.

Essential Safety Precautions

  • Always keep your belongings close and secure, especially important documents and electronic devices.
  • Be cautious of your surroundings and avoid sharing sensitive information in public places.
  • Stay alert and be aware of common scams or risks in the area you are visiting.

Importance of Travel Insurance and Emergency Preparedness

  • Invest in travel insurance that covers medical emergencies, trip cancellations, and lost luggage to mitigate unexpected expenses.
  • Create a comprehensive emergency plan that includes contact information for local authorities, embassies, and emergency services.
  • Carry essential emergency items such as a first aid kit, flashlight, and emergency contact card.

Tips for Staying Vigilant and Secure

  • Avoid sharing travel plans on social media to prevent potential security threats.
  • Use secure Wi-Fi networks and VPNs to protect sensitive data while working remotely.
  • Keep copies of important travel documents in a separate location in case of loss or theft.
